Namibia's Commercial & Industrial Landscape

Namibia presents a highly challenging geographical environment characterized by extreme climatic variation. From the hyper-arid, wind-blown dunes of the Namib Desert to the high-salinity coastal air of Walvis Bay and Swakopmund, infrastructure must withstand significant physical stressors. In Windhoek, the rapid modernization of commercial real estate demands state-of-the-art flooring systems that combine elite-level aesthetics with functional grit protection.

Furthermore, Namibia’s mineral resource sector—including uranium mining in Rössing and Husab, alongside extensive diamond extraction facilities—necessitates specialized matting that can cope with heavy grease, coarse silica dust, and high mechanical loads. Without premium, specialized entrance barriers, interior flooring substrates degrade rapidly, incurring massive maintenance and replacement overheads.

Macro-Industry Architectural Floor Protection Solutions

How technical matting systems function as the primary structural defense for commercial real estate, logistics hubs, and industrial sites.

Silica Sand Capture Systems

Utilizing high-grooved patterns and monofilament carpet inserts designed to scrape, extract, and conceal wind-borne sand before it damages internal hard floors.

Maritime Salt & Humidity Barriers

Designed for coastal ports like Lüderitz, incorporating anti-corrosive structural aluminum frames and UV-treated synthetics that resist salt spray degradation.

Heavy Duty Load Capacity

Engineered to withstand the intense wheeled loads of trolleys, forklifts, and heavy foot traffic in retail centers, airport terminals, and industrial warehouses.

Local Application Scenarios in Namibian Architecture

Engineered variations designed to thrive in specific infrastructure configurations across the country.

Corporate Offices in Windhoek

Polished aluminum profile zones with premium textile inserts that blend seamlessly with modern commercial aesthetics while keeping Kalahari sand off interior floor surfaces.

Eco-Tourism Lodges in Sossusvlei

Heavy-duty, weather-resistant natural coir and UV-stabilized rubber compounds that endure extreme diurnal temperature fluctuations (from chilly nights to scorching desert days).

Industrial Mines near Swakopmund

Thick, oil-resistant Nitrile rubber matting designed to scrape heavy mechanical soil, resist grease degradation, and safeguard industrial workstations.

Procurement & Technical FAQ for Namibian Projects

Get answers to common technical queries from architects, project engineers, and procurement officers.

What is the typical shipping timeline to Namibia?

Standard marine transit to the Port of Walvis Bay requires approximately 20 to 30 days depending on vessel scheduling. Customs clearance and transit to Windhoek generally add 5 to 7 business days.

How do materials withstand high UV exposure in desert environments?

Our outdoor mats incorporate UV-inhibiting chemical additives within both the PVC and Nitrile rubber compounds. This prevents structural degradation, cracking, and color fading under intense sunlight.

Are custom dimensions and brand logo integration supported?

Yes. Utilizing advanced high-precision cutting and digital printing systems, we can customize logo details, brand color profiles, and structural dimensions to align with specific floor recess layouts.

Which matting design is best suited to manage sand influx?

For high sand loads, we recommend our heavy-duty aluminum grid systems with coarse monofilament carpet inserts or ribbed PVC profiles. These scrap sand off shoes and collect it in channels below walking level.

What quality standards are certified?

Our production workflows conform to ISO 9001 and ISO 14001 guidelines. Our commercial-grade entrance matting is flame retardant, REACH compliant, and certified for slip resistance under international testing metrics.

How are the products cleaned and maintained?

Most rubber-backed and PVC-backed items can be pressure-washed, vacuumed, or machine-washed in standard commercial laundering systems. Aluminum grid systems can be rolled up to sweep away collected dirt underneath.
